Ejemplo n.º 1
0
    $template->assign("roles", $allroles);
    $template->assign("allfolders", $allfolders);
    $template->assign("postmax", $POST_MAX_SIZE);
    $template->display("projectfiles.tpl");
} elseif ($action == "addfolder") {
    if (!$userpermissions["files"]["add"]) {
        $errtxt = $langfile["nopermission"];
        $noperm = $langfile["accessdenied"];
        $template->assign("errortext", "<h2>{$errtxt}</h2><br>{$noperm}");
        $template->display("error.tpl");
        die;
    }
    $name = getArrayVal($_POST, "foldertitle");
    $desc = getArrayVal($_POST, "folderdesc");
    $parent = getArrayVal($_POST, "folderparent");
    if ($myfile->addFolder($parent, $id, $name, $desc)) {
        $loc = $url .= "managefile.php?action=showproject&id={$id}&mode=folderadded";
        header("Location: {$loc}");
    }
} elseif ($action == "delfolder") {
    if (!$userpermissions["files"]["del"]) {
        $errtxt = $langfile["nopermission"];
        $noperm = $langfile["accessdenied"];
        $template->assign("errortext", "<h2>{$errtxt}</h2><br>{$noperm}");
        $template->display("error.tpl");
        die;
    }
    $ajaxreq = $_GET["ajax"];
    $folder = getArrayVal($_GET, "folder");
    if ($myfile->deleteFolder($folder, $id)) {
        if ($ajaxreq = 1) {
Ejemplo n.º 2
0
    $template->assign("folders", $finfolders);
    $template->assign("members", $members);
    $template->assign("roles", $allroles);

    $template->assign("allfolders", $allfolders);
    $template->assign("postmax", $POST_MAX_SIZE);
    $template->display("projectfiles.tpl");
} elseif ($action == "addfolder") {
    $name = getArrayVal($_POST, "foldertitle");
    $desc = getArrayVal($_POST, "folderdesc");
    $parent = getArrayVal($_POST, "folderparent");
    $visible = getArrayVal($_POST, "visible");
    if (empty($visible[0])) {
        $visible = "";
    }
    if ($myfile->addFolder($parent, $id, $name, $desc, $visible)) {
        $loc = $url .= "managefile.php?action=showproject&id=$id&mode=folderadded";
        header("Location: $loc");
    }
} elseif ($action == "delfolder") {
    $ajaxreq = $_GET["ajax"];
    $folder = getArrayVal($_GET, "folder");
    if ($myfile->deleteFolder($folder, $id)) {
        if ($ajaxreq = 1) {
            echo "ok";
        } else {
            $loc = $url .= "managefile.php?action=showproject&id=$id&mode=folderdel";
            header("Location: $loc");
        }
    }
} elseif ($action == "movefile") {